Q: Is 251,464 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 251,464 is not a prime number.

Why is 251,464 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 251464 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 17 34 43 68 86 136 172 344 731 1,462 1,849 2,924 3,698 5,848 7,396 14,792 31,433 62,866 125,732 and 251,464, with no remainder.

Since 251,464 cannot be divided by just 1 and 251,464, it is not a prime number.
